What are the licensing requirements for daycare providers in Cleaton, Kentucky, and how can I verify a facility is properly licensed?

In Cleaton and throughout Kentucky, all childcare centers and certified family childcare homes must be licensed by the Kentucky Cabinet for Health and Family Services (CHFS), Division of Child Care. Licensing ensures providers meet minimum standards for health, safety, staff-to-child ratios, staff qualifications, and facility safety. You can verify a provider's license status, view inspection reports, and check for any serious violations by using the free online "Child Care Finder" tool on the Kentucky CHFS website. For very small in-home providers (caring for only the children of one unrelated family), licensing is not required, so it's crucial to ask about their policies and safety measures directly.

What is the average cost of full-time daycare for an infant or toddler in Cleaton, and are there any financial assistance programs available locally?

In the Cleaton area and surrounding Muhlenberg County, full-time daycare for an infant typically ranges from $125 to $175 per week, while toddler care may be slightly lower, around $110 to $150 per week. These costs can vary based on the center's amenities, curriculum, and age of the facility. For financial assistance, Kentucky offers the Child Care Assistance Program (CCAP) for income-eligible families. You can apply through the Muhlenberg County Department for Community Based Services (DCBS). Additionally, some local centers may offer sliding scale fees or sibling discounts, so it's always worth asking directly.

Are daycare waitlists common in Cleaton, and how far in advance should I start looking for infant care?

Yes, waitlists for infant care, in particular, are common in Cleaton due to the limited number of facilities and stricter staff-to-child ratios required for younger children. It is highly recommended that expecting parents begin researching and contacting daycare centers as early as their second trimester, or at least 6-9 months before their needed start date. Some popular centers may have waitlists that extend several months. For toddler or preschool-aged spots, starting your search 3-4 months in advance is advisable. Be prepared to place a deposit to hold a spot on a waitlist.

What types of childcare settings are most commonly available in Cleaton, KY?

Cleaton offers a mix of childcare settings, though options are more limited than in larger cities. The most common types are: 1. **Licensed Childcare Centers:** These are standalone facilities, often associated with churches or community organizations, offering care for larger groups with structured programs. 2. **Certified Family Child Care Homes:** Small, home-based providers licensed to care for a limited number of children (up to 12), often offering a more home-like environment. 3. **Registered Family Child Care Homes:** Similar to certified homes but with slightly different regulations. Due to Cleaton's small size, many families also consider providers in nearby communities like Greenville, Central City, or Beaver Dam. In-home nannies or babysitters are less common and are typically arranged privately.

What should I look for during a daycare tour in Cleaton, and are there any local resources to help me compare options?

During a tour, observe cleanliness, safety (outlet covers, secure gates, clean toys), and how staff interact with children—are they engaged and responsive? Ask about staff turnover, daily schedules, meal plans, sick policies, and their emergency procedures for severe weather common to Western Kentucky. Specifically for Cleaton, inquire about their plan for school closures or delays that might affect staff, as many commute. For comparing options, use the state's **Child Care Finder** website as your primary resource. You can also contact the **Muhlenberg County Family Resource and Youth Services Centers (FRYSCs)** located in local schools; they often have information on reputable local childcare providers and community support programs.
